Blagovescensk vs Maimana Climate & Distance Between

Afghanistan flag
  • The distance between Blagovescensk, Russia and Maimana, Afghanistan is approximately 5,169 km or 3,212 mi.
  • To reach Blagovescensk in this distance one would set out from Maimana bearing 51.5° or NE and follow the great circles arc to approach Blagovescensk bearing 97.1° or E .
  • Blagovescensk has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with dry winters (Dwb) whereas Maimana has a Mediterranean hot climate (Csa).
  • Blagovescensk is in or near the boreal moist forest biome whereas Maimana is in or near the cool temperate desert scrub biome.
  • The average annual temperature is 14 °C (25.2°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 18.6 °C (33.5°F) more in Blagovescensk. The continentality subtype is truly continental as opposed to subcont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 217.1 mm (8.5 in) more which is equivalent to 217.1 l/m² (5.33 US gal/ft²) or 2,171,000 l/ha (232,094 US gal/ac) more. About 1 3/5 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 14.4° lower in Blagovescensk than in Maimana.
  • Relative humidity levels are 13.3% higher.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 9.3°C (16.7°F) lower.
